description In this paper, the rational exponential solutions of two space-time fractional equal-width (FEW) equations are explored in the conformable derivative sense. The way to reach explicit exact solutions is to transform the fractional order PDEs into a nonlinear ODEs of discrete order through some properties of conformable derivatives and a fractional complex transforms. The subsequent equations have been elucidated by employing the exp a function approach. Some new exact solutions of the said equations are effectively formulated and graphically conveyed with the aid of symbolic computation in Mathematica and MATLAB respectively.
